欢迎来到天天文库
浏览记录
ID:40475058
大小:61.01 KB
页数:3页
时间:2019-08-03
《Java软件开发工程师简历》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、个人简历姓名性别年龄学历毕业院校专业工作经验现居住地移动电话电子邮件【技术】Ø熟悉java语言,理解oop思想,了解多线程,知道Socket编程,对UDP/TCP网络协议有一定的了解。Ø熟练使用EL表达式、ognl、JSP、Servlet等WEB应用的开发技术。Ø熟悉jQuery、javaScript、Ajax等前端WEB技术,JavaWeb中防盗链的原理机制。Ø熟练JavaEE的主流开发技术,对Struts2、Spring、Hibernate等企业主流开发框架技术有较深入了解。Ø了解Mybatis的CRUD操作,能够使用Myba
2、tis+Struts2+Spring架构整合Ø熟悉JBPM工作流引擎,能够独立完成工作流的定制和控制。Ø熟悉Lucene,了解搜索引擎的运行原理,Hibernate中的二级缓存存储原理。Ø能使用HibernateSearch3.4.2+二级缓存来优化sql查询。Ø熟悉熟练应用MySQL、Orcal等关系型数据库,掌握SQL程序语言,利用JDBC操作数据库。Ø理解hadoop处理大数据的运行机制,能够搭建hadoop集群。Ø理解hadoop中HDFS与MapReduce交互数据的底层原理机制,了解Hbase的表存储、zookeepe
3、r协调管理hadoop、Hbase。Ø了解HTML5、webservice(Axis2/CXF)、NoSQL非关系型数据库等技术。【工作经验】武汉泷收电子系统工程有限公司飞达物流管理配送系统(项目一)12/09--13/08开发技术struts2.3.7+spring3.2+hibernate3.6+JBPM4.4+jqueryeasyui+ztree开发工具MyEclipse8.5+jdk7.0+Tomcat6+MySQL5.0+PowerDesigner项目描述此系统作为服务前端,客户通过电话、网络等多种方式进行委托,业务受理
4、员通过与客户交流,获取客户的服务需求和具体委托信息,将服务指令输入我公司服务系统。该系统是物流管理的前端系统,其核心模块主要有:基本设置模块、取派业务模块、中转配送模块、用户模块、权限模块、财物管理等。担任职务Java软件工程师责任描述主要负责功能权限管理模块(自定义权限模型+自定义标签)、中转配送模块(JBPM)、业务受理模块(POI批量导入)1、分页优化:由于客户输入的数据量较大,工作单比较多,以及货物的出库、入库上面,用一页都是显示不完的,这样一来,就会导致,下拉框长,不便于观看,所以在多个位置都要用来分页显示,且由于多个位
5、置需要用来分页,所以根据面向对象的五大原则,我们将分页功能设置成为了一个接口,将分页需要用到的对象抽取出来,一旦某个位置需要用来分页,便直接实现这个接口即可,这样一来,就可以提高工作效率,代码逻辑也非常清晰,也便于解偶。2、JBPM工作流引入:为了解决货物在配送过程中的繁琐低效性,在中转配送流程的模块中,使用jbpm工作流,实现了货物的中转环节,入库、出库、配送签收的流程程中各个节点流程的控制和信息在节点的传递;管理员可以部署相应的流程定义的文件或更新一个流程定义,同时还可以管理流程申请模板,同样也可以起草一个流程申请和查看自己的
6、申请信息;每个环节对应的角色,也可以查看自己的任务,和流程进行到了哪一步,这样一来,每个角色,就不用去想流程到了哪一步,自己需要做些什么,就提高了工作效率。3、自定义标签设计:由于客户需求,页面的菜单要根据角色权限的不同,页面显示的菜单就不同,当某角色无此权限时,不显示此菜单,这里引入了自定义标签来设计,利用SimpleTag标签库来完成。4、自定义一套权限管理模型由于客户需求,我们要针对角色的不同,使用SpringSecurity其角色针对的权限的不同,页面的左边栏,会根据相应的角色的权限动态生成菜单,同时,在action类中的
7、方法上面,针对页面中的按钮进行细粒度的控制,以及JBPM中,每个流程所针对的角色进行控制显示,这样一来,每个人都知道自己对应的任务,使其显示更加清晰,用自定义注解控制权限好处,灵活性很强,添加注解进行控制,删除注解取消控制。迅达商贸管理系统(项目二)12/3--12/08开发技术struts2.3.7+spring3.2+hibernate3.6+jquery+json开发工具MyEclipse8.5+jdk7.0+Tomcat6+MySQL5.0项目描述随着公司发展业务发生变化,原有的系统已无法满足企业新需求,因此在此背景下研发
8、本系统。实现各地、各部门人员快速高效协作;本系统的应用,实现异地网上统一办公,实现人员工作效率和质量的提升,也为管理层随时掌握公司运营数据提供了便捷的渠道.本系统主要分为以下几个模块:系统首页、货运管理、基础管理、系统管理等担任职务Java软件工程
此文档下载收益归作者所有